Divide and Conquer is the third installment in Frank Capra’s Why We Fight World War II propaganda series, co-directed with Anatole Litvak. It was commissioned by the U.S. War Department to explain the Nazi conquest of Western Europe in 1940.

No other engineer has received more awards for their work on the Mars Rovers than Donald Bickler. Yet, you've never heard of him. This documentary tells the story of how he became a legend at JPL, and won NASA's highest engineering medal.

Documentary that shows the ways human beings exploit non human animals for food, clothing, vivisection, entertainment and for use as pets. Graphic imagery is shown. Directed by Shaun Monson and narrated by Joaquin Phoenix.
